The US Smart Exoskeleton Market is witnessing remarkable growth as advanced wearable robotics continue to transform rehabilitation, mobility assistance, and industrial applications. Smart exoskeletons, designed to enhance human strength, endurance, and mobility, are increasingly adopted in healthcare, manufacturing, and military sectors. Driven by technological innovation and rising demand for assistive devices, the market is expected to expand significantly in the coming years.

Key Drivers of Market Growth

Several factors are fueling the growth of the US Smart Exoskeleton Market. Rising cases of mobility impairments, aging populations, and the need for rehabilitation solutions are key contributors. Additionally, industries are increasingly integrating exoskeletons to reduce worker fatigue, improve efficiency, and prevent injuries.

The market is also influenced by technological advancements. AI-driven control systems, lightweight materials, and enhanced battery efficiency are making smart exoskeletons more practical and user-friendly.
